FAECULA

\fˈiːkjʊlə], \fˈiːkjʊlə], \f_ˈiː_k_j_ʊ_l_ə]\

Definitions of FAECULA

Word of the day

mind-cure

  • Pretended cure of disease by mental influence.
View More